* Rename simdjson_really_inline -> simdjson_inline I want to change the simdjson_really_inline macro to sometimes not force inlining. After that upcoming change, the name simdjson_really_inline will no longer makes sense. Rename simdjson_really_inline to simdjson_inline. This patch should not change semantics; simdjson_inline still forces inlining as before. Some functions still need to be really inlined for ABI reasons. (GCC's -Wpsabi complains otherwise.) Leave those functions marked as simdjson_really_inline. * Improve build times for debug builds simdjson_inline is used for most simdjson functions. It forces inlining. In unoptimized/debug builds, this can lead to a lot of machine code being generated (especially with Address Sanitizer), causing slow compilation. Change simdjson_inline to force inlining only for optimized builds. Sometimes, the programmer might want a slightly-optimized build and want fast compilation (e.g. GCC's -Og mode). Allow simdjson users to define the simdjson_inline macro themselves (e.g. on the command line: -Dsimdjson_inline=inline) in cases where the default behavior is undesired. This patch reduced build times by over 75% for ondemand_object_tests.cpp with GCC 9.4.0 and CMAKE_BUILD_TYPE=Debug on my AMD 5950X: Before: 6.885 6.683 6.971 6.957 6.949 seconds (5 samples) After: 1.492 1.551 1.494 1.490 1.531 seconds (5 samples)
